Heim >Web-Frontend >js-Tutorial >Was sind die gängigen Ajax-Steuerelemente? Erfahren Sie mehr über seine Funktionen und Fähigkeiten
Umfassendes Verständnis der Ajax-Steuerelemente: Was sind die häufigsten?
Einführung:
In der modernen Webentwicklung ist Ajax (Asynchrones JavaScript und XML) zu einer beliebten Technologie geworden, mit der eine teilweise Aktualisierung von Webseiten realisiert und die Benutzererfahrung verbessert werden kann. In der Entwicklung verwenden wir normalerweise Ajax-Steuerelemente, um unseren Entwicklungsprozess zu vereinfachen und zu beschleunigen. In diesem Artikel werfen wir einen detaillierten Blick auf Ajax-Steuerelemente und stellen einige gängige Steuerelemente und ihre Funktionen vor.
1. jQuery Ajax:
jQuery Ajax ist eines der am häufigsten verwendeten Ajax-Steuerelemente. Es handelt sich um eine schnelle, übersichtliche JavaScript-Bibliothek, die eine umfangreiche und leistungsstarke API bereitstellt und es Entwicklern erleichtert, Ajax-Anfragen und -Antworten zu verarbeiten. Mit jQuery Ajax können wir Funktionen wie das asynchrone Laden von Daten, das Senden von Formularen und das Aktualisieren dynamischer Inhalte implementieren. Es unterstützt mehrere Datenformate wie JSON, XML usw. und bietet außerdem umfangreiche Rückruffunktionen für die Verarbeitung verschiedener Phasen des Anfrageprozesses.
2. Vue.js:
Vue.js ist ein beliebtes JavaScript-Framework, das häufig zum Erstellen moderner Webanwendungen verwendet wird. Es kann problemlos komplexe Datenbindungen und dynamische Ansichtsaktualisierungen verarbeiten, einschließlich Ajax-Anfragen und -Antworten. Das datengesteuerte Modell von Vue.js macht die Aktualisierung von Daten einfach und effizient. Es bietet viele integrierte Anweisungen und Methoden, um das asynchrone Laden und Rendern von Daten zu erleichtern.
3. React.js:
React.js ist eine weitere beliebte JavaScript-Bibliothek, die hauptsächlich zum Erstellen von Benutzeroberflächen verwendet wird. Ähnlich wie Vue.js unterstützt React.js auch Ajax-Anfragen und -Antworten. Mit React.js können wir Daten einfach an Komponenten binden und sie bei Bedarf lokal aktualisieren. React.js bietet ein Konzept namens „virtuelles DOM“, das die Dateninteraktion und das Rendering zwischen Komponenten effizient verwaltet.
4. AngularJS:
AngularJS ist ein beliebtes JavaScript-Framework, das von Google entwickelt und zur Entwicklung umfangreicher Webanwendungen verwendet wird. Es bietet umfangreiche Funktionen, einschließlich Ajax-Anfragen und -Antworten. Die Kernidee von AngularJS ist die bidirektionale Datenbindung, die Datenaktualisierungen und Seitenaktualisierungen einfacher und effizienter macht. Es bietet außerdem viele integrierte Dienste und Anweisungen, um das asynchrone Laden und Verarbeiten von Daten zu erleichtern.
5. Axios:
Axios ist ein Promise-basierter HTTP-Client, der in Browsern und Node.js verwendet werden kann. Es bietet eine übersichtliche und benutzerfreundliche API, die das Senden von Ajax-Anfragen einfacher und zuverlässiger macht. Über Axios können wir Anfragen und Antworten problemlos verarbeiten, einschließlich JSON-Datenanalyse, Anforderungsabfang und Antwortabfang. Axios unterstützt auch gleichzeitige Anfragen und Stornierungsanfragen und bietet so eine gute Leistung und Skalierbarkeit.
6. Fetch API:
Fetch API ist eine neue Methode, die in HTML5 zum Senden und Empfangen von HTTP-Anfragen eingeführt wurde. Es bietet eine modernere und prägnantere Möglichkeit, Ajax-Anfragen zu senden. Die Fetch-API wird mit Promise erstellt, unterstützt asynchrone Vorgänge und bietet Verarbeitungsmethoden für mehrere Datentypen. Mit der Fetch-API können wir ganz einfach Anfragen senden, Anfrageparameter festlegen und Antwortergebnisse verarbeiten.
Zusammenfassung:
Die oben genannten sind einige gängige Ajax-Steuerelemente, die eine wichtige Rolle bei der Webentwicklung spielen. Unabhängig davon, ob sie zum einfachen Laden von Daten oder zum Erstellen komplexer Webanwendungen verwendet werden, bieten diese Steuerelemente leistungsstarke und flexible Funktionen. Entwickler können geeignete Steuerelemente auswählen, um die Entwicklungsarbeit entsprechend ihren Bedürfnissen und Vorlieben abzuschließen. Die Beherrschung der Verwendung dieser Steuerelemente kann Entwicklern dabei helfen, moderne Webanwendungen effizienter zu entwickeln.
Das obige ist der detaillierte Inhalt vonWas sind die gängigen Ajax-Steuerelemente? Erfahren Sie mehr über seine Funktionen und Fähigkeiten.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!